Taiwanese Government Encourages Chinese Investors to Enter the ICT Industry While People Oppose

Zou Chi

A scholar-organized alliance launched a petition on the Internet opposing the trade pact opening up the information and communication technology (ICT) industry for Chinese investors. According to the petition, the Taiwanese integrated-circuit-design industry accounted for 22% of the global market share in 2014, which ranks second in the world, following the US.

Alibaba Launches US$ 307 Million Fund for Taiwan Start-ups

Zou Chi

Alibaba executive vice chairman Joseph Tsai points out, executive chairman Jack Ma found out from talking to Taiwanese entrepreneurs that the common concern is a lack of young successors. In order to help young people build start-ups, Alibaba will give out NT$10 billion (approximately US$ 307 million) of venture funds.
